In Accra, the Makola Market is a lively hub where vendors sell everything from colorful textiles to fresh produce. It's a place to experience the city's heartbeat away from the tourist trails. Just down the road, the Jamestown district offers a glimpse into Accra's colonial past with its lighthouse and the remnants of British architecture. This area is also known for its street art, providing a colorful canvas of the local culture. For a taste of traditional Ghanaian cuisine, head to Buka Restaurant in Osu, where you can savor dishes like jollof rice and fufu. Osu is also home to Oxford Street, a busy thoroughfare filled with shops and eateries, perfect for an evening stroll. Nearby, the Artists Alliance Gallery showcases contemporary Ghanaian art, offering a different perspective on the city’s creative scene.

Highlights

  • Kwame Nkrumah Mausoleum — Final resting place of Ghana's first President, with reflecting pools and a museum.
  • Labadi Beach — Popular spot for locals and tourists, known for its lively atmosphere and local musicians.
  • W.E.B. Du Bois Center — Dedicated to the African-American scholar, with a library and his personal memorabilia.
  • Osu Castle — Former seat of government, offering historical tours and views of the Gulf of Guinea.
  • Makola Market — Central market known for its range of goods, from textiles to traditional crafts.

Geheimtipps

Jamestown Cafe

A cultural hub offering local drinks and occasional live music, set in a historic building.

Legon Botanical Gardens

A serene escape with canopy walkways, perfect for a leisurely afternoon.

Kane Kwei Carpentry Workshop

Famed for its custom-made, artistic coffins in shapes like fish and airplanes.

Praktische Tipps

  • ·Traffic can be heavy; consider using a ride-hailing app like Bolt to navigate the city efficiently.
  • ·Cash is king; many smaller vendors and eateries do not accept cards, so carry Ghanaian cedis.
  • ·Visit the National Museum of Ghana on a weekday to avoid crowds and have a more intimate experience.
  • ·Stay in the Osu neighborhood for easy access to nightlife and dining options.
